Job description



Responsibilities

Day-to-Day Responsibilities:

· 

Performs Quality Control (QC) reviews (four-eye) on KYC files for wholesale banking and institutional broker-dealer clients as part of the ongoing KYC periodic reviews process.

· 

Identifies client-specific documentary and due diligence requirements to complete the QC review.

· 

Adheres to the established QC scoring methodology and applies the accepted file quality passage rate applicable to ECM reviews. Completes files by assigned deadlines.

· 

Verifies specific KYC due diligence tasks performed to complete ECM files, including sanctions and negative news screening, PEP identification, customer risk scoring, and alignment with FinCEN regulatory requirements.

· 

Reviews and creates KYC summary memos for assigned KYC files.

· 

Identify and provide clear feedback to Analyst (2-Eyes) on quality assessment issues

· 

Creates and maintain customer information, documents in bank databases/systems.

· 

Works closely with KYC Analysts, Managers, Front Office, Relationship Managers and Bank Compliance in providing continuous feedback on status of accounts.

· 

Participates in committees and meetings as required related to the ECM function throughout the client lifecycle.

· 

Contribute to firm-wide CLD projects related to integration, systems, data remediation, and adherence to KYC policies and procedures.

· 

Interfaces with Quality Assurance and internal testing functions to ensure that KYC file quality is maintained.

· 

Perform escalations of risk factors to the required compliance teams in line with group policy

· 

Participates in training for new and current joiners.

Business Insight

The Operations Department (OPER) ensures the operational processing and control of activity across all Global Banking and Investor Solutions (GBIS) business lines (Capital Markets, ex-Newedge & Financing). OPER implements all necessary means to ensure the operational, administrative and financial processing of capital markets and credit operations initiated by these business lines. In addition, OPER ensures the control and security of transaction processing in accordance with current financial regulations while acting as the first level of control on operations and booking quality. OPER provide all necessary support during the lifecycle of the transaction, perform Know Your Customer processing and provide general client relationship management. OPER also acts to steer the evolution of regulatory projects and controls our external service providers.

CLIC (Client Lifecycle Intelligence and Care) is the global cross-business client management division for Societe Generale. CLIC's mission is to provide a simplified, differentiated experience for SG's clients and employees over the client's entire lifecyle. Within CLIC, the CLM (Client Lifecycle Management) department has primary responsibility for:

·  Coordinating the onboarding process
·  Managing client data with a guarantee of quality and completeness
·  Protecting the bank and its clients by applying KYC regulations
